If your washing machine smells after cleaning it, the most likely cause is mould or mildew hiding in places the clean cycle does not actually reach — particularly the rubber door seal, the detergent drawer, or internal drum vents. Residual soap scum and hard water deposits also trap bacteria that produce that sour, musty odour. Running a cleaning cycle helps, but it is rarely enough on its own. What Usually Goes Wrong First Most failed zero threshold shower installations on wood subfloors share a common origin: the waterproofing was either rushed or undersized. Water finds every gap, every pinhole, and every unsealed penetration. On a concrete slab, a small leak is annoying. On a wood subfloor, it causes rot, mould, and structural damage within 12 to 18 months. The case for careful planning is not hypothetical. Contractors who have had to tear out a two-year-old shower because the subfloor failed learn this lesson once and never repeat it. Every time you log into a website, add something to a shopping cart, or stay signed in while browsing, a session cookie is almost certainly doing the work behind the scenes. They are one of the most fundamental pieces of how the web works—acting as a temporary memory for the browser—yet most people have no idea they exist. A session cookie is a small piece of data stored in your browser that helps a website remember who you are during a single browsing session.
